Quick Example
Create a Module
import com.forthix.forthic.annotations.Word;
import com.forthix.forthic.module.DecoratedModule;
public class AnalyticsModule extends DecoratedModule {
public AnalyticsModule() {
super("analytics");
}
@Word(stackEffect = "( numbers:List -- avg:Double )", description = "Calculate average")
public Double AVERAGE(Object numbers) {
List<?> nums = (List<?>) numbers;
return nums.stream()
.mapToDouble(n -> ((Number) n).doubleValue())
.average()
.orElse(0.0);
}
@Word(stackEffect = "( numbers:List stdDevs:Number -- filtered:List )",
description = "Filter outliers beyond N std devs")
public List<Object> FILTER_OUTLIERS(Object numbers, Object stdDevs) {
// Your existing logic here
return filteredNumbers;
}
}
Use It
import com.forthix.forthic.interpreter.StandardInterpreter;
StandardInterpreter interp = new StandardInterpreter();
interp.registerModule(new AnalyticsModule());
interp.run("""
["analytics"] USE-MODULES
[1 2 3 100 4 5] 2 FILTER-OUTLIERS AVERAGE
""");
Object result = interp.stackPop(); // Clean average without outliers

Getting Started
Basic Usage
import com.forthix.forthic.interpreter.StandardInterpreter;
StandardInterpreter interp = new StandardInterpreter();
// Execute Forthic code
interp.run("[1 2 3 4 5] '2 *' MAP"); // Double each element
List<?> result = (List<?>) interp.stackPop(); // [2, 4, 6, 8, 10]
Creating Your First Module
import com.forthix.forthic.annotations.Word;
import com.forthix.forthic.module.DecoratedModule;
public class MyModule extends DecoratedModule {
public MyModule() {
super("mymodule");
}
@Word(stackEffect = "( data:List -- result:Object )", description = "Process data your way")
public Object PROCESS(Object data) {
// Wrap your existing Java code
return myExistingMethod(data);
}
}
// Register and use
StandardInterpreter interp = new StandardInterpreter();
interp.registerModule(new MyModule());
interp.run("""
["mymodule"] USE-MODULES
SOME-DATA PROCESS
""");

Features
Standard Library
The Java runtime includes comprehensive standard modules:
- array - MAP, SELECT, SORT, GROUP-BY, ZIP, REDUCE, FLATTEN (30 operations)
- record - REC@, <REC!, RELABEL, KEYS, VALUES, INVERT-KEYS (10 operations)
- string - SPLIT, JOIN, UPPERCASE, LOWERCASE, STRIP, REPLACE (17 operations)
- math - +, -, *, /, ROUND, ABS, MIN, MAX, MEAN (24 operations)
- datetime - >DATE, >DATETIME, ADD-DAYS, TODAY, NOW (15 operations, java.time API)
- json - >JSON, JSON>, JSON-PRETTIFY (3 operations, Jackson)
- boolean - ==, <, >, AND, OR, NOT, IN (15 operations)

Easy Module Creation
The @Word annotation makes wrapping code trivial:
@Word(stackEffect = "( input:Type -- output:Type )", description = "Description")
public Object MY_WORD(Object input) {
return yourLogic(input);
}
Java Integration
- Java 15+ compatibility
- Works with Spring Boot, Jakarta EE, standalone applications
- Thread-safe interpreter instances
- Native java.time API for datetime operations
- Jackson for JSON serialization
DirectWord Support
For polymorphic operations that need to inspect the stack:
@Word(stackEffect = "( a b | array -- result )",
description = "Add two numbers or sum array",
isDirect = true)
public void PLUS(BareInterpreter interp) {
Object top = interp.stackPop();
if (top instanceof List) {
// Sum array
double sum = ((List<?>) top).stream()
.mapToDouble(n -> ((Number) n).doubleValue())
.sum();
interp.stackPush(sum);
} else {
// Add two numbers
Object a = interp.stackPop();
double result = ((Number) a).doubleValue() + ((Number) top).doubleValue();
interp.stackPush(result);
}
}

Multi-Runtime Execution
Call code from other language runtimes seamlessly - use Python's pandas from Java, or TypeScript's JavaScript libraries from Java.
Quick Example
import com.forthix.forthic.interpreter.StandardInterpreter;
import com.forthix.forthic.grpc.GrpcClient;
import com.forthix.forthic.grpc.RemoteModule;
StandardInterpreter interp = new StandardInterpreter();
// Connect to Python runtime
GrpcClient client = new GrpcClient("localhost:50051");
RemoteModule pandas = new RemoteModule("pandas", client, "python");
pandas.initialize();
interp.registerModule(pandas);
// Now use Python pandas from Java!
interp.run("""
["pandas"] USE-MODULES
[records] DF-FROM-RECORDS
""");
Approaches
- gRPC - Java ↔ Python ↔ TypeScript ↔ Ruby (fast, server-to-server)
- WebSocket - Browser ↔ Java (client-server)

Cross-Runtime Compatibility
This Java implementation maintains compatibility with:
- forthic-ts (TypeScript/JavaScript)
- forthic-py (Python)
- forthic-rb (Ruby)
- forthic-rs (Rust, in progress)
All runtimes share the same test suite and language semantics to ensure consistent behavior across platforms.
